Countrywide chief executive Alison Platt has acquired approximately £250,000 worth of shares, the property services group confirmed. In a short statement on Tuesday, the FTSE 250 group said Platt purchased 41,700 ordinary shares, representing 0.019% of the company's issued share capital, at 595.50p
